如何搭建安卓服务器端
-
要搭建安卓服务器端,需要按照以下步骤进行操作。
第一步:选择合适的服务器平台
首先,需要选择一个适合安卓服务器端的平台。常用的服务器平台包括Apache、NGINX等。可以根据项目需求和个人偏好选择适合自己的服务器平台。第二步:准备服务器环境
在选择好服务器平台后,需要准备服务器环境。首先,确保服务器具备操作系统,如Linux、Windows等。然后,需要安装服务器软件,如Apache、NGINX等。可以根据服务器平台的官方文档,按照指导进行安装和配置。第三步:安装和配置安卓开发环境
在服务器环境准备好后,需要安装和配置安卓开发环境。下载并安装Android Studio,这是一个官方提供的开发工具,用于开发安卓应用和进行测试。安装完成后,根据Android Studio的官方文档,按照指导进行配置。第四步:编写服务器端代码
接下来,需要编写服务器端代码。可以使用Java、Kotlin等安卓开发语言进行编写。根据项目需求和功能要求,编写相应的接口和逻辑代码,用于处理客户端的请求和返回相应数据。第五步:部署服务器端代码
完成服务器端代码的编写后,需要将代码部署到服务器上。可以使用Git等版本管理工具将代码上传到服务器中。然后,按照服务器平台的要求,进行相应的配置和部署操作,确保服务器可以正确运行。第六步:测试服务器端
在部署完成后,需要进行服务器端的测试。可以使用Postman等工具模拟客户端的请求,检查服务器端是否正常响应,并返回正确的数据。同时,也可以进行性能测试,评估服务器的负载能力和稳定性。总结:
搭建安卓服务器端需要选择合适的服务器平台,准备服务器环境,安装和配置安卓开发环境,编写服务器端代码,部署服务器端代码,测试服务器端。通过以上步骤,可以成功搭建安卓服务器端,并提供服务于安卓客户端。1年前 -
搭建安卓服务器端需要进行多个步骤和配置。以下是详细的步骤:
-
选择服务器架构:首先,您需要确定要使用的服务器架构。常见的服务器架构包括Java服务器、Node.js服务器和Python服务器等。
-
确定服务器需求:在搭建服务器之前,您需要考虑您的应用程序的需求。例如,您需要支持多少个并发连接?您需要处理大量数据传输吗?您需要支持实时通信吗?根据这些需求,您可以选择适合的服务器配置。
-
选择合适的服务器软件:根据您的服务器架构和需求,选择合适的服务器软件。例如,如果您选择Java服务器,您可以选择使用Apache Tomcat、Jetty或WildFly等软件。
-
安装和配置服务器软件:根据您选择的服务器软件,按照相应的安装指南进行安装和配置。这通常涉及到设置环境变量、配置端口号等。
-
编写服务器端代码:使用所选的服务器软件和编程语言,编写服务器端代码。这段代码负责处理来自客户端的请求,执行相应的操作,并返回结果。根据您的应用程序需求,您可能需要编写数据库操作、文件上传、身份验证等功能。
-
部署和测试服务器:在服务器端代码编写完毕后,将代码部署到服务器上,并进行测试。确保服务器能够正常运行,并能够处理来自客户端的请求。
-
配置安全性和性能:最后,您需要配置服务器的安全性和性能。这包括设置防火墙、SSL证书、性能调优等。
总结起来,搭建安卓服务器端需要选择合适的服务器架构和软件,安装和配置服务器软件,编写服务器端代码,部署和测试服务器,以及配置安全性和性能。通过按照这些步骤进行操作,您将能够成功搭建安卓服务器端。
1年前 -
-
搭建安卓服务器端主要涉及以下几个步骤:
1、选择服务器端框架。
2、准备服务器环境。
3、编写服务器端代码。
4、部署服务器。
5、测试服务器端。下面将详细介绍每个步骤的方法和操作流程。
选择服务器端框架
服务器端框架是搭建安卓服务器端的基础,可以选择适合自身需求的框架,常用的框架有:
- JavaEE:提供了多种技术和组件,如Servlet、JSP、EJB等。
- Spring框架:提供了丰富的功能,如IOC容器、AOP等。
- Node.js:基于JavaScript运行时环境,适用于高并发的实时应用。
- Django框架:基于Python的开源Web框架,适用于快速开发高质量的Web应用。
选择框架时需要考虑自身的编程语言水平和开发需求,以及框架的稳定性和社区支持等因素。
准备服务器环境
在搭建安卓服务器端之前,需要准备好服务器环境,主要包括服务器硬件和软件的准备。
- 硬件:选择一台稳定可靠的服务器,可以自行购买或者租用云服务器。
- 操作系统:安装一个适合服务器需求的操作系统,如Linux、Windows Server等。
- 数据库:选择合适的数据库系统,如MySQL、Oracle、MongoDB等。
- Web服务器:选择常用的Web服务器,如Apache、Nginx等。
此外,还需要安装Java开发环境(如果选择JavaEE框架)、Node.js(如果选择Node.js框架)等。
编写服务器端代码
选择了服务器端框架和搭建好服务器环境之后,接下来就是编写具体的服务器端代码了。
首先,需要确定服务器端的主要功能和业务逻辑,根据需求设计好数据库表结构和接口规范。然后,根据框架的要求,编写相应的代码。
如果选择JavaEE框架,可以使用Servlet和JSP来编写服务器端代码。Servlet处理请求和响应,JSP用于生成动态的HTML页面。
如果选择Spring框架,可以使用Spring MVC来处理请求和响应,使用Spring ORM来操作数据库。
如果选择Node.js框架,可以使用Express来处理请求和响应,使用Mongoose来操作数据库。
如果选择Django框架,可以使用Django的MTV(模型-模板-视图)模式来开发服务器端。
编写服务器端代码需要掌握相应的编程语言和框架的知识,可以参考官方文档、教程和示例代码。
部署服务器
服务器端代码编写完成之后,需要将其部署到服务器上,让其可以运行和提供服务。
部署的具体方法可以根据选择的框架和服务器环境而定,以下是一般的部署步骤:
1、将服务器端代码上传到服务器上。可以使用FTP、SCP等工具将代码文件复制到服务器上指定的目录。
2、配置服务器环境。根据框架和服务器的要求,进行相应的配置。例如,配置数据库连接、配置Web服务器、配置域名等。
3、启动服务器。根据不同的框架,可以使用相应的命令启动服务器,如运行JavaEE应用可以使用Tomcat服务器启动。
测试服务器端
部署完成之后,需要对服务器端进行测试,确保其功能正常、稳定可靠。
可以使用专业的接口测试工具,如Postman、JMeter等,模拟客户端请求服务器,并分析服务器返回的结果。
测试过程中需要注意以下几个方面:
- 测试服务器的性能:模拟并发请求,测试服务器的负载能力和响应速度。
- 测试服务器的安全性:测试服务器的防护机制,如防火墙、反射攻击、数据加密等。
- 测试服务器的稳定性:长时间运行测试,观察服务器是否出现异常、崩溃等情况。
根据测试结果,及时修复服务器端的问题,确保其正常运行。
总结起来,搭建安卓服务器端主要包括选择服务器端框架、准备服务器环境、编写服务器端代码、部署服务器和测试服务器端五个步骤。根据自身需求和技术水平选择合适的框架和环境,并根据框架的要求编写相应的代码,经过测试和调试后部署服务器,最终确保服务器端功能正常运行。
1年前